« SPARQL Protocol and RDF Query Language/Présentation de la leçon » : différence entre les versions

Contenu supprimé Contenu ajouté
m Robot : Remplacement de texte automatisé (-n'importe +n’importe)
m Robot : Remplacement de texte automatisé (- d'offrir + d’offrir )
Ligne 1 :
SPARQL (prononcer « {{Lang|en|''sparkle''}} », en anglais « étincelle ») est un langage de requêtes et un protocole qui permet de rechercher, d'ajouter, de modifier ou de supprimer des données {{w|Resource Description Framework|RDF}} disponibles à travers Internet. Son nom est un acronyme qui signifie « {{Lang|en|SPARQL Protocol and RDF Query Language}} ».
 
SPARQL est l'équivalent de SQL, car, comme en SQL, on accède aux données d'une base de données {{Lang|la|''via''}} ce langage de requêtes. Avec SPARQL, on accède aux données du Web des données. Cela signifie qu'en théorie, on pourrait accéder à toutes les données du Web avec ce standard. L'ambition du W3C est d'offrird’offrir une interopérabilité non seulement au niveau des services, comme avec les services Web, mais aussi au niveau des données, structurées ou non, qui sont disponibles à travers l'Internet.
 
SPARQL est un langage de requêtes. Il permet de récupérer des informations depuis des serveurs SPARQL (ou {{Lang|en|''endpoint''}} SPARQL), aussi appelés {{Lang|en|''triplestore''}}. Parmi ces {{Lang|en|''triplestores''}}, on peut citer 4Store, Sesame, Jena et bien d'autres.